Output 6893baf44696731e148637b69fe1fba6bb4aea3c0dd08567ae57284be76dd97e:3

value
820500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3440f95491ea9d404918a9bcde5d628486916b5f OP_EQUALVERIFY OP_CHECKSIG
address
15mHySm6LRWRraqN7FRCEHnLDDWYFCxmDW
transaction
6893baf44696731e148637b69fe1fba6bb4aea3c0dd08567ae57284be76dd97e
spent
true